Morocco: 16%  increase in tourist arrivals despite the economic crisis
Morocco (Rabat) - The tourism sector is robust despite the economic slump thanks to measures taken by the Moroccan government to address the world financial crisis, Tourism Minister Yassir Zenagui said.

"The different measures taken by the government allowed us to keep the business on the right track," Zenagui told US TV channel CNN.

He noted that tourist arrivals rose by 16% during the first quarter of 2010 versus a year before.

He added that these results are the upshot of the reforms put in place by the north African country to raise the quality of the Moroccan product.

The Minister stressed that the Moroccan financial system was not affected by the crisis and the banks did not have any exposure to subprime markets.         

"Morocco had a 6% growth in a difficult time, while most countries of the region had a negative progression," he said.
